What Can You Do with a Bachelor’s in Medical Laboratory Science?

The online Bachelor of Science in Medical Laboratory Science degree can help you position yourself for success in a variety of work environments, including management and leadership roles in diverse health care settings.

With laboratories across the nation facing shortages of medical laboratory scientists, there has never been a better time to earn your bachelor’s degree and advance your career – according to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, medical laboratory scientist jobs are projected to grow 11% from 2020 to 2030, faster than the average for all occupations. In addition, as of May 2021, the average wage for a medical laboratory scientist is $77,000 annually.

Opportunities After Graduation:
  • Medical laboratory scientist
  • Medical laboratory management
  • Clinical supervisor
  • Research and development
  • Forensics
  • Technical specialist
  • Education and instruction
  • Laboratory information specialist
